The Crowning with Thorns

Lucas Cranach (I) · 1509 · houtsnede; paper

From the collection of Rijksmuseum, Amsterdam. Free to download, adapt and use — no permission needed.

About this work

The soldiers of Pilate have crowned the sitting Christ with a crown of thorns, put a mantle on him, and given him a scepter. Two soldiers press the crown with large thorns firmly onto Christ's head with two sticks. A man kneels before him while mockingly sticking out his tongue; another man lies flat on the ground with two dogs while watching laughing. In the background stand various men of the court. Against the wall top right hang two shields with the electoral and ducal arms of Saxony.
